Sixty years ago, on December 28, 1957, the Detroit Lions handed the Cleveland Browns a big loss, deciding the world’s football championship by a margin of 59-14. Even though the Lions did win by such an overwhelming decision, it was no fault of Lathrop’s Paul Wiggin, who was a stalwart on defense for the Browns. Wiggin played football for the local high school and went on to become an All-American tackle at Stanford.
